DebugCenter - 嘉立创EDA开源硬件平台

编辑器版本 ×
标准版 Standard

1、简单易用,可快速上手

2、流畅支持300个器件或1000个焊盘以下的设计规模

3、支持简单的电路仿真

4、面向学生、老师、创客

专业版 professional

1、全新的交互和界面

2、流畅支持超过3w器件或10w焊盘的设计规模,支持面板和外壳设计

3、更严谨的设计约束,更规范的流程

4、面向企业、更专业的用户

标准版 DebugCenter

简介:多功能调试器【已完结】

开源协议: GPL 3.0

(未经作者授权,禁止转载)

创建时间: 2020-06-28 16:33:08
更新时间: 2021-06-27 09:56:29
描述

多功能一体调试器
在公司调试板件的时候经常会用到各种调试器,有的板件还需要外部供电,经常要接很多线,会比较凌乱,所以有了做这样一个多功能调试器的想法。
其实这个整体结构很简单,就是USBHUB加上各种想要的功能,整合在一个板子上,并没有什么技术难度的。
我这里只是给大家提供一个思路,大家可以根据这个思路结合自己的想法做出适合自己的东西。
目前的版本主要包含以下几个功能:
1.DAP-LINK(开源的)
2.USB_Blaster(用的PIC单片机方案)
3.UART*2(可选RS485)
4.USB快充(μP9616)
5.3.3V、5V输出,最大2A
这个版本只是暂时用用,最终想把每一个功能做成一个小板件,在做一个母线板放USBHUB,这样就可以自由组合了。
更新日志:
20.07.05 第一版完成,准备打板测试(可能会有BUG,请谨慎使用)

21.01.30 V1.1版本准备打板测试(可能会有BUG,请谨慎使用)

21.04.01 V1.1版本测试完成,可以使用

——————————————————————————————————

2021.01.30更新

调试器第一个版本其实早就完成了

DBGV0.1

焊接完成后测试

USBHUB正常,每个端口都能用;

DAPlink有点问题,原理图是参照技小新的,刷完固件后发现电脑设置中能识别到设备,设备管理器里能识别到虚拟串口,但是没有DAP,KEIL找不到设备。

USB-blaster正常,安装好驱动后能识别,下载功能正常,调试功能暂时没法试;

UART和485测试都没问题

USB快充正常,用小米6X可以识别到快充;

24V转3V正常;

24V转5V电源部分纹波巨大,且带载能力极弱。因为24V转3V部分正常,所以怀疑是布线问题。

VPP后边搞5V这一路DCDC花了不少时间,确定是地线布局有问题,中间改了一版,但是因为中间出了点事,没能打板子测试。

现在大家看到的是V1.1版,主要有以下几点改动:

1.删除了USB快充功能,这个感觉比较鸡肋;

2.DAP-Link换了一个方案

3.两路DC输出更换了芯片,结构较之前简单一点,不太容易出问题;

4.规整了原理图,看起来比较清晰

5.PCB尺寸进一步缩小,还画了一个上盖,叠起来会比较好看

暂时就这样吧,后边新版本测完了再更新。

——————————————————————————————————

——————————————————————————————————

2021.04.01更新

咕了好久,这个工程终于完结了。

其实前好几天就焊接完成了,一直拖着没有测,这两天有闲工夫晚上花了点时间搞定了。

——————————————————————————————————

测试结果如下:

1.12V转5V/3.3V测试正常

     V1.1版本的DCDC芯片换成了TPS562200,经测试两路都能正常工作,纹波略大,但是在能接受的范围内

2.DAP-LINK测试正常

     这次的DAP-LINK换了一个图,经测试可以正常下载调试,串口功能也正常

3.USB-Blaster测试正常

     这个和之前的一样,没啥问题的

4.USB转TTL串口测试正常

     两路CH340E测试都没问题,两路同时以1382400的波特率自发自收测试了一段时间,没有出现误码

5.RS485测试正常

    和串口测试一样的波特率,两路互相收发,测试了一段时间没有出现误码

——————————————————————————————————

——————————————————————————————————

至此,这个工程就彻底完结了,后面应该是不会再更新了

接下来打算做一个集合JLINK-V9、USB-Blaster、USB-232、USB-485的工具,估计得好几个月半年才能完工了

UB和DAP的固件在附件里

设计图
未生成预览图,请在编辑器重新保存一次
ID Name Designator Footprint Quantity
1 SL2.1A U2 SOP-16_L10.0-W3.9-P1.27-LS6.0-BL 1
2 22uF C3,C2,C1,C45,C35,C43,C42,C33,C32 C0805 9
3 SS34_C13762 D1,D11 SMB_L4.6-W3.6-LS5.3-R-RD 2
4 100nF C7,C12,C10,C15,C14,C13,C8,C19,C17,C20,C21,C46,C29,C36,C38,C25,C31,C41,C27,C40,C48,C44,C50,C23,C34,C51,C52 C0603 27
5 USBLC6-2SC6 D2 SOT-23-6_L2.9-W1.6-P0.95-LS2.8-BR 1
6 12MHz X1,X3 OSC-SMD_2P-L5.0-W3.2 2
7 MF-NSMF110-2 U1 F1206 1
8 10uF C6,C5,C4,C47,C28,C22,C39,C37,C49,C30,C24 C0603 11
9 TYPE-C16PIN USB1 USB-C-SMD_TYPE-C16PIN 1
10 4.7K R13,R3,R4,R2,R5,R10,R15,R29,R36,R33,R37 R0603 11
11 22 R7,R8 R0603 2
12 Z-211-0211-0021-001 H1 HDR-TH_2P-P2.54-V 1
13 22pF C9,C11,C16,C18 C0603 4
14 NCD0603R5 LED3,LED1,LED6,LED5,LED7,LED9,LED8,LED10,LED11 LED0603-RD 9
15 D-G060306G1-KS2 LED4 LED0603-RD 1
16 Header-Male-2.54_1x3 H2 HDR-TH_3P-P2.54-V 1
17 FC-A1608BK-465M LED2 LED0603-RD 1
18 1.5K R6 R0603 1
19 100 R9,R20,R22,R25,R23,R26,R24,R21,R27,R19 R0603 10
20 8MHz X2 OSC-SMD_L5.0-W3.2 1
21 10K R11,R12,R14,R1,R18,R32,R30,R35 R0603 8
22 Z-231011010106 CN1,CN4 IDC-TH_Z-231011010106 2
23 XH-4A CN3,CN2 CONN-TH_4P-P2.50_XH-4A 2
24 STM32F103C8T6TR U3 STM-LQFP48 1
25 Header-Male-2.54_1x6 H3 HDR-TH_6P-P2.54-V 1
26 1K R28,R43,R41,R38,R40 R0603 5
27 0 R16,R17 R0603 2
28 PIC18F14K50-I/SS U4 SSOP-20_L7.2-W5.3-P0.65-LS7.8-BL 1
29 210S-2*6P H4 HDR-TH_12P-P2.54-V-R2-C6-S2.54 1
30 CH340E U5,U6 MSOP-10_L3.0-W3.0-P0.50-LS5.0-BL 2
31 SMBJ6.0CA D3,D4,D5,D7,D8,D6,D9,D10 SMB_L4.6-W3.6-LS5.3-BI 8
32 A2541WV-2X5P U8,U10 HDR-TH_10P-P2.54-V-R2-C5-S2.54_A2541WV-2X5P 2
33 DC-044A-2.5A-2.5 DC1 DC-IN-TH_DC-044A-2.5A-2.0 1
34 56K R31 R0603 1
35 220uF C26 CAP-SMD_BD8.0-L8.3-W8.3-FD 1
36 33.2K R34 R0603 1
37 4.7uH L1,L2 IND-SMD_L6.8-W6.8_SMMS0630 2
38 TLC-LSMD300D F1 F2920 1
39 TPS562200DDCR U7,U9 SOT-23-6_L2.9-W1.6-P0.95-LS2.8-BR 2
40 SC662K-3.3V LDO2,LDO4,LDO3,LDO1 SOT-23-3_L2.9-W1.3-P1.90-LS2.4-BR 4
41 120 R39,R42 R0603 2
42 JL301-50003U01 U12,U14 CONN-TH_3P-P5.08_JL301-50003U01 2
43 Header-Male-2.54_2x3 J1,J2 HDR-TH_6P-P2.54-V-R2-C3-S2.54 2
44 77311-102-03LF H6,H5 HDR-TH_3P-P2.54-V 2
45 ADM3485ARZ-REEL7 U13,U11 SOIC-8_L4.9-W3.9-P1.27-LS6.0-BL 2

展开

工程视频/附件
序号 文件名称 下载次数
1

固件.zip

8
工程成员
侵权投诉
相关工程
换一批
加载中...
添加到专辑 ×

加载中...

温馨提示 ×

是否需要添加此工程到专辑?

温馨提示
动态内容涉嫌违规
内容:
  • 153 6159 2675

服务时间

周一至周五 9:00~18:00
  • 技术支持

support
  • 开源平台公众号

MP